Summer Envy: The Social Media Effect on Parenting and Well-Being

In this episode, Shira opens up about a personal experience she shared on Instagram that struck a chord with many. Regardless of whether you’re a parent or not, the theme of comparison is something that resonates universally.

As the summer began, Shira found herself feeling low and caught in a harmful habit of comparing herself to others, particularly concerning her son, Oliver. The pressure to provide him with an extraordinary summer experience led her into a negative thought loop that seemed difficult to escape.

Reflecting on the impact of comparison, Shira shares how this seemingly innocent behavior can significantly affect our well-being, particularly in the realm of social media. Instead of advocating for complete disconnection, she introduces the concept of “mental fullness” – recognizing when comparison becomes detrimental and taking proactive steps to counter it.
